Satellite-to-Satellite tricking (SST) data can be used to determine the orbits of spacecraft in two ways. One is combined orbit determination, which combines SST data with ground-based tracking data and exploits the enhanced tracking geometry. The other is the autonomous orbit determination, which uses only SST. The latter only fits some particular circumstances since it suffers the rank defect problem in other circumstances. The proof of this statement is presented. The nature of the problem is also investigated in order to find an effective solution. Several. methods of solution are discussed. The feasibility of the methods is demonstrated by their application to a simulation. 展开更多

The electrochemiluminescence (ECL) of luminol in aqueous alkaline solution was studied. Trace amounts of chloride showed significant effect on the efficiency of light emission of luminol as a posi- tive trigonometrical wave pulse was exerted on the solution. The detection limit for the chloride is 5.0 ×10^(-6) mol/L and the linear calibration range extends up to 1.0 ×10^(-2) mol/L; the relative standard deviation for 1.0 ×10^(-5) mol / L chloride is 5%. The influencing factors for chloride determination are also discussed. The possible mechanism for the electrochemiluminescence reaction may be due to the oxidation of chloride ion in the solution to ClO^-, and the latter acts on luminol and then gives out luminescence. The method has been applied to determine the total chloride in tap water with satisfactory results. 展开更多

The article adopts the quarterly data of the monetary and macroeconomics variables from 1978~1999, applies the asymmetrical information game analysis, the regression and cointegration error-correction model, to investigate on the decision-making mechanism of money supply and money regulation project. It suggests the regulation process which central bank controls with instruments of the monetary policy and the mode detail of its operation. 展开更多
